The front page shows all markers.
But you are redirecting the page at GD > Advanced Search > First time load redirect > Redirect to nearest location (on first time load users will be auto geolocated and redirected to nearest geolocation found).
That means that the page goes to a “city” only.
Turn that setting off if you do not like the redirect.You can also change GD > Multilocations > Home page should go to > Site root (ex: mysite.com/) so it is easier for visitors to go back to the home page.
